| I do a lot of wet blending, and there are numerous ways to learn how to do it.
My method is to get 3 to 5 colors ( Shade, base, highlight and maybe depending on my mood and what I am trying to do, a few extreme shade or in-between colors) ready on the pallette.
Then I apply my base and go from there using the same brush I have my clean water ready so I can quickly clean the brush and apply fresh color on a clean brush or just recharge my brush as is. It kind of depends on how much paint is on the brush when I am ready to apply the next color.
When I was learning, I used a retarder to help with the drying time, but I have gotten to the point where I no longer need that, I've just learned to be quicker.
